The United Nations Summit on Food Systems +2 opens this Monday, July 24 in Rome on Monday, July 24 and should allow an inventory of sustainable initiatives that have emerged since the last edition in 2021 in order to make them available to all players in the food sector.
This summit in which the President of the Kais Saied Republic takes part, must examine the global agrifood systems two years after this last edition.
It will continue until Wednesday at the headquarters of the United Nations Food and Agriculture Organization (FAO) and will see the participation of 2,000 personalities from 160 countries.
